Setting Up the Book. Go into the Book panel menu and choose Book Page Numbering Options. Choose: Continue on next even page. Check on both Insert Blank Page and Automatically Update Page & Section Numbers. Click OK. Type in the name of your newspaper and from either the top Controls panel or the Character and Paragraph panels (Window > Type & Tables > Character) adjust the Font to Pioggia .Dec 29, 2022 · If you want to keep working in printer spreads, you need to resection the pages to the correct numbers. An easy way to remember how to number the pages is to take your final page count and add one (in this case, 28+1=29) with the high/low page numbers alternating. Each spreads numbers have to equal 29: pages 28+1, pages 2+27, page 26+3, etc.)

The Pages panel can display absolute numbering (labeling all pages with consecutive numbers, starting at the first page of the document) or section numbering (labeling pages by section, as specified in the Section Options dialog box).. Changing the numbering display affects how pages are indicated in the InDesign document, as in the Pages panel and in the page box at the bottom of a document ...LATEST. So when I added my footnotes I deleted the numbers InDesign added. When I add new footnotes I, too, get numbers.To export pages A-3 through C-10, I could enter +3-+10 in the dialog box. For absolute numbers, you can also use the syntax of placing a hyphen before or after the range. For example: -+3 would print from the beginning of the document to the absolute third page. Or, +7- prints from absolute page 7 to the end of the file.Open the Pages panel and double-click on a master page. If you cannot find it, open the panel by clicking on Window > Pages. Right-click the tab for an open document and choose New Document from the in-context menu.Sep 24, 2013 · Subhead 1 is the second level of numbering in this document, and “^H.^2.^t” tells InDesign to type the chapter number (^H), a period (.), the subhead number (^2) and a tab (^t) in front of the each Subhead 1, “1.1, 1.2, 1.3”. When set up as shown, the ^2 numbers will increment automatically. 4. Set up Subhead 2 numbering. On to Subhead 2.
